Is a third walk safe for my energetic puppy's developing joints?

Updated On September 23rd, 2025

Pet's info: Dog | Pug | Female | unspayed | 3 months and 17 days old

I have 13 week old pug with lots of energy. I’ve been advised by a neighbour to limit walks to two a day for fear of damaging her joints, but she’s full of energy and I think would really like to take her for a 3rd. We’re normally out for around 20 minutes each time and I wait till she tells me she wants carrying home. Is it safe to increase to 3rd?

The best person to ask if this is OK is Gerty’s regular veterinarian. It is important that her joints are palpated prior to increasing the activity. If everything is normal, it is likely fine to increase to another 15 to 20 minute walk a day. In general low impact activities, assuming they are not excessively long, are fine and good for muscle development. It’s very important however to have this checked first. Best of luck.
